Pearl Royals secured a thrilling six-wicket win against Jobur Super Kings in Match 15 of the SA20 2025 at Boland Park. Despite Jonny Bairstow’s valiant half-century for the Super Kings, Miller’s composed knock guided the Royals to a comfortable victory with five balls to spare.
After being put into bat, the Super Kings struggled to find momentum in the early part of their innings. Devon Conway (7) and Faf du Plessis (18) fell cheaply, while Leus du Plooy managed just 6 runs. Jonny Bairstow anchored the innings with a brilliant 60 off 40 balls, including two fours and three sixes, displaying his trademark aggressive stroke play.
Bairstow found support from Donovan Ferreira, who contributed a powerful 32* off 19 balls, including one four and two sixes. However, the rest of the lineup failed to capitalize, with Moeen Ali (1) and Sibonelo Makhanya (17) struggling to get going.
The Royals bowlers kept things under control, with Bjorn Fortuin being the pick of the bowlers, taking 2 wickets for just 22 runs in his four overs. Joe Root took 1 for 16 in his economical spell, while Mujeeb Ur Rahman and Dayyaan Galiem also claimed a wicket each.
Chasing a paltry target of 147, the Royals began a flurry as Lhuan-dre Pretorius smashed 27 off just 14 balls, including 4 fours and a six. However, quick wickets from Hardus Viljoen and Imran Tahir set them back, leaving them at 68/3.
Mitchell Van Buuren played a stabilizing knock, scoring 44 off 45 balls, but it was David Miller who stole the show. The southpaw showed his trademark composure under pressure, scoring an unbeaten 40 off 32 balls with three fours and a six. Miller’s calculated aggression and intelligent strike rotation ensured that the Royals remained ahead of the required run rate. The home team reached the finish line in 19.1 overswith 6 wickets in hand.
Tahir bowled a smooth spell for the Super Kings, taking 1 for 22 in his four overs, while Viljoen claimed 2 for 23. However, a lack of support from the other bowlers allowed the Royals to sail away. in victory that is easy.
